摘要
In this paper, we analyze a bulk input Geom[X]/Geom/1 queue with single working vacation. Using the matrix analysis method, highly complicated PGF of the stationary queue size is firstly derived, from which we got the stochastic decomposition result for the PGF of the stationary queue size. It is important that we find the biparameter addition theorems of the conditional negative binomial distribution, with which we find the upper bound and the lower bound of the stationary waiting time in the moment generating function order. Furthermore, we gain the mean queue size and the upper bound and the lower bound of the mean waiting time. Finally, several numerical examples are presented
